Abstract

The utility model belongs to the field of sand tables, in particular to a model design visual customization sand table, aiming at the problems that the flexibility of the existing model design visual customization sand table is poor, the operation of adjusting the placing position is time-consuming and labor-consuming, the displayed angle and height can not be adjusted according to the actual requirement, the comfort level of a viewer for observing the sand table is not high, and the design is not humanized enough, the utility model proposes the following scheme, which comprises a supporting seat, wherein the bottom of the supporting seat is provided with a lower groove, the inside of the lower groove is provided with a jacking supporting component, the top of the supporting seat is provided with an upper groove, and the inner wall of the bottom of the upper groove is fixedly provided with a rotary display motor.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Example one
Referring to fig. 1-4, a model design visual customization sand table comprises a supporting seat 1, a lower groove 2 is arranged at the bottom of the supporting seat 1, the lower groove 2 is arranged in a rectangular shape, a jacking support assembly is arranged in the lower groove 2, in order to drive a moving wheel 5 to move downwards and jack the supporting seat 1, the jacking support assembly comprises a jacking cylinder 3, a fixed plate 4 and a plurality of moving wheels 5, the top of the jacking cylinder 3 and the inner wall of the top of the lower groove 2 are fixedly installed, the bottom of an output shaft of the jacking cylinder 3 and the top of the fixed plate 4 are fixedly installed, the outer side of the fixed plate 4 and the inner wall of the lower groove 2 are connected in a sliding manner, the plurality of moving wheels 5 are respectively arranged at two sides of the bottom of the fixed plate 4, at least four moving wheels 5 are arranged, the plurality of moving wheels 5 are arranged in a matrix shape and can keep balance, in order to improve the positioning accuracy, positioning blocks are fixedly installed on the inner walls on the left side and the right side of the lower groove 2, the two positioning blocks are located below the fixed plate 4 and used for positioning the fixed plate 4, a protection pad is fixedly mounted at the bottom of the supporting seat 1 and is arranged in a frame shape, the protection pad is located on the outer side of the lower groove 2 and can be selected according to actual requirements, an upper groove 6 is formed in the top of the supporting seat 1, a rotary display motor 7 is fixedly mounted on the inner wall of the bottom of the upper groove 6, an adjusting column 8 is fixedly mounted at the top of an output shaft of the rotary display motor 7, a disc is further arranged at the top of the output shaft of the rotary display motor 7, the top of the disc and the bottom of the adjusting column 8 are fixedly mounted to increase the contact area, the adjusting column 8 is arranged in a hollow mode, the bottom of the adjusting column 8 is rotatably connected with the top of the supporting seat 1, a threaded sleeve 11 is arranged inside the adjusting column 8, and a sliding column is fixedly mounted at the top of the threaded sleeve 11, the top of traveller extends to the top of adjusting the post 8 and fixed mounting has mounting panel 15, and the bottom of mounting panel 15 and adjusting the post 8 can contact also can break away from, and angle adjusting cylinder 17 is installed in the top rotation of mounting panel 15, and swing joint has sand table body 21 on the angle adjusting cylinder 17 output shaft.
Example two
The following further improvements are made on the basis of the first embodiment:
in the utility model, in order to conveniently adjust the height of the sand table body 21, an adjusting motor 9 is fixedly arranged on the inner wall of the bottom of an adjusting column 8, the specification of the adjusting motor 9 can be selected according to actual requirements, a screw rod 10 is fixedly arranged on the top of an output shaft of the adjusting motor 9, the top of the screw rod 10 extends into a threaded sleeve 11 and is in threaded connection with the inside of the threaded sleeve 11, an internal thread matched with the screw rod 10 is arranged inside the threaded sleeve 11, a limiting part is arranged on the threaded sleeve 11, in order to improve the transmission reliability, the limiting part comprises two connecting handles 14 and two limiting sliders 13, the two connecting handles 14 are arranged in a splayed shape, the sides, far away from each other, of the two limiting sliders 13 are respectively in sliding connection with the inner wall on the left side and the inner wall on the right side of the adjusting column 8, the limiting sliders 13 are in sliding connection with the side wall of the adjusting column 8 through a sliding rail and a sliding groove, the bottom of the connecting handles 14 are in rotating connection with the front side of the limiting sliders 13 corresponding to the adjusting column, the top of two connecting handles 14 rotates with the left side and the right side of threaded sleeve 11 respectively to be connected, in order to make the altitude mixture control of sand table body 21 more gentle and stable, the equal fixed mounting in bottom of two spacing slider 13 has retarding spring 12, retarding spring 12 can make the longitudinal movement of threaded sleeve 11 more gentle, and the equal fixed mounting in bottom of two retarding spring 12 has the diaphragm, the one end that two diaphragms kept away from each other respectively with the left side inner wall and the right side inner wall fixed mounting of regulation post 8, for the convenience of installation retarding spring 12.
In the utility model, in order to adjust the display angle of the sand table body 21, two L-shaped rods are fixedly mounted on the right side of the mounting plate 15, one side, close to each other, of each of the two L-shaped rods is rotatably mounted with the same support shaft 20, the support shaft 20 can rotate, the top of the support shaft 20 extends to the upper side of the adjusting column 8 and is fixedly mounted with the bottom of the sand table body 21, the sand table body 21 can be vertical, the top of the mounting plate 15 is fixedly mounted with a rotating seat 16, the front side of the rotating seat 16 is rotatably connected with the rear side of the angle adjusting cylinder 17, the angle adjusting cylinder 17 can also rotate, two connecting plates 18 are fixedly mounted at the bottom of the sand table body 21, one side, close to each other, of the two connecting plates 18 is fixedly mounted with the same movable shaft 19, and the movable shaft 19 is movably connected with the output shaft of the angle adjusting cylinder 17.
In the utility model, in order to improve the visual effect displayed by the sand table body 21, four pieces of toughened glass 22 are fixedly arranged at the top of the sand table body 21, the number of the toughened glass 22 is four, the four pieces of toughened glass 22 surround a circle to protect the sand table body 21, the top of the sand table body 21 is fixedly provided with a neon lamp ring 23 and a lamp circuit 24, in order to improve the display effect, the number of the lamp circuits 24 is multiple, the lamp circuits 24 are arranged in a groined shape, the lamp belts are arranged on the lamp circuits 24, the lamp belts and the neon lamp ring 23 are electrically connected with the same storage battery, and the specification and the placement position of the storage battery can be determined according to actual requirements.
In the utility model, when the sand table is used, the sand table body 21 is normally placed, when the placement position of the sand table body 21 is changed according to actual requirements, the switch of the jacking cylinder 3 is pressed, the output shaft of the jacking cylinder 3 drives the fixed plate 4 and the moving wheel 5 to move downwards, when the bottom of the fixed plate 4 is tightly attached to the top of the positioning block, the moving wheel 5 just can support the sand table body 21, and then the sand table body 21 is pushed to move to a new placement position, when a fixed display mode needs to be changed in the display process, the rotary display motor 7 is started, the adjusting column 8 and the sand table body 21 rotate along with the output shaft of the rotary display motor 7, the sand table body 21 can slowly rotate, a viewer can view the overall appearance of the sand table body 21 without changing the position, when the height of the sand table body 21 needs to be adjusted according to the height of the viewer, the adjusting motor 9 is started, make screw rod 10 follow the output shaft of regulation formula motor 9 and rotate, because screw rod 10 and 11 threaded connection of threaded sleeve, can turn into threaded sleeve 11's longitudinal movement with screw rod 10's rotation, and then drive mounting panel 15 and sand table body 21 longitudinal movement, after starting angle adjust cylinder 17, sand table body 21 can be around carrying out pitch arc motion around back shaft 20, and then change the angle of show, compare conventional model design vision customization sand table, sand table body 21's flexibility is high, it is convenient to remove it, can adjust sand table body 21's height and angle according to viewer's situation, can improve viewer's the comfort level of watching sand table body 21, design more hommization.
